Rain thwarts BMW, Toro Rosso at Imola

A heavy rain once again thwarted the BMW and Toro Rosso teams in testing at the Imola circuit

Although the rain stopped at times during the day, the track was very wet in the morning and didn't dry up in the afternoon.

While the Toro Rosso team decided to call it a day earlier, BMW did the best they could under the circumstances and carried out a full programme.

In the morning, Jacques Villeneuve and Robert Kubica did long-runs on extreme wet tyres and in the afternoon they tested intermediates. Villeneuve covered a total of 92 laps and finished ahead of Kubica.

Toro Rosso cut their scheduled programme back to just one car for Scott Speed, who again practiced pitstops, completing 34 laps.

"Looking at the bad conditions, we took the decision to continue with pitstop practice," said chief engineer Laurent Mekies. "It was pretty much our only option and with around 20 pit stops completed, the crew have really sharpened their skills."

Today's times:

Pos  Driver        Team                      Time      Laps
 1.  Villeneuve    BMW-Sauber           (M)  1:30.866   92
 2.  Kubica        BMW-Sauber           (M)  1:31.939   86
 3.  Speed         Toro Rosso-Cosworth  (M)  1:38.290   34

All Timing Unofficial
